Pelina similis Papp, 1974 View in CoL

( Fig. 34 View FIGURES 34–35 )

Pelina similis Papp, 1974: 406 View in CoL .

Specimens examined. 1 ♂, Asir, Abha, Madenate Al-Ameer Sultan , 25. ii.–25. v. 2002, Malaise trap. H.A. Dawah ( CERS) .

Distribution. This is the first record from Saudi Arabia. This species was described from Hungary (Domsod, Apaj-puszta) and further recorded from Azerbaijan, Czechia, Greece, Romania, Turkmenistan, and Ukraine.
